The Importance of WordPress Rest API

While creating web applications with WordPress, engineers associate the application to outsider projects and administrations through explicit application programming interfaces (APIs). They further utilize an assortment of APIs to upgrade the WordPress application’s usefulness and client experience. WordPress REST API empowers developers to associate their application to other programming and administrations in an easier and progressively effective way. The engineers can utilize the module to influence their WordPress application to associate with different sites and administrations by defeating contrasts in information forma and back-end programming dialects.

Understanding Important Aspects of WordPress REST API

JSON Data Format

They can utilize the module to influence the WordPress application to speak with outsider programming and administrations by sending and getting JavaScript Object Notation (JSON) objects. JSON is a cutting edge and intelligible information group. Likewise, JSON has encoders and decoders for most broadly utilized programming dialects. Thus, the WordPress application and outsider programming can trade information in a commonly comprehensible configuration. The designers can additionally interface their WordPress application consistently to an assortment of programming and administrations by composing basic JavaScript code.

REST Methodology

WordPress has planned the module as an all inclusive connector by utilizing Representational State Transfer (REST) philosophy. Notwithstanding having a basic information group, REST likewise enables engineers to utilize regularly utilized HTTP strategies like POST, GET, DELETE and PUT. In the meantime, the system can encourage trade of information in both XML and JSON design. The REST approach disentangles the correspondence between two projects. It further makes the WordPress application trade information with different sites and administrations in both XML and JSON position.

Similarity with Other Web Programming Languages

While creating sites with WordPress, developers need to compose code in PHP. At present, PHP is the most mainstream server-side programming language. Be that as it may, it needs many propelled highlights given by present day programming dialects like Ruby, Java and C#. Subsequently, numerous engineers these days lean toward composing web applications in present day programming dialects. The WordPress REST API will make it less demanding for software engineers to associate WordPress applications to different sites and administrations paying little mind to their server-side programming language. The consistent association will additionally assist developers with eliminating regular similarity issues.

Encourage Custom Web Application Development

The WordPress REST API will make it less demanding for designers to manufacture custom web applications as indicated by fluctuating business prerequisites. As they can utilize the module to get to outsider data and assets from numerous sources, the designers can without much of a stretch upgrade the look, feel, and usefulness of the web application. Numerous engineers can additionally make custom sites without depending on customary WordPress interface. They can additionally utilize the device to assemble the front-end and back-end of a WordPress application in an altogether new and progressively productive way. Know More about WordPress baserad sida

Improve WordPress Applications for Mobile Devices

At present, significant versatile working frameworks like iOS and Android support JSON information position. As WordPress REST API enables applications to trade information in JSON design, it winds up simpler for software engineers to improve WordPress applications for cell phones. Numerous engineers can utilize the module to designer and run versatile applications with WordPress. They can additionally create and convey portable applications productively by utilizing WordPress as the back-end. The WordPress REST API will empower numerous engineers to make local portable applications by utilizing their current programming aptitudes.